About Elizabeth
I have over 20 years experience of working with adults and young people aged 16+.
I have worked in a variety of settings and enjoy offering different approaches which I integrate to best match particular needs.
I also provide a creative space with a variety of media to use including clay, paint, postcards and miniature figures. Using the arts needs no previous experience, the focus is on self-expression rather than being artistic and is always invitational, not an expectation.
I have worked with a large range of presenting problems including physical, sexual and emotional abuse, self-harm and suicide, anxiety, stress, panic attacks, work-related issues, bereavement and loss, depression, identity, life stages, relationship issues, eating disorders, miscarriage, infertility, stillbirth and SIDS.
I am an Accredited Counsellor and a member of the British Association of Counsellors and Psychotherapists, whose ethical framework I abide by.
I am also an accredited counsellor with The Foundation for Infant Loss.
I have a diploma in Counselling and Integrative Arts Psychotherapy, a certificate in Advanced Transactional Analysis Psychotherapy as well as a diploma in Supervision from The Link.
Counselling
Counselling is a collaborative relationship where we both work together, in a supportive environment, on the things that may be troubling you.
Sharing a problem can be hugely beneficial and counselling provides a safe and regular space for you to talk and explore difficult emotions.
It can be a great relief to share your worries and fears with someone who acknowledges your feelings and works towards helping you reach a solution.
